April 5, 2008 7 p.m. Allen Theatre, Playhouse Square
Tony Award-winning choreographer and tap dancer Savion Glover is featured in the world premiere of Diaspora of the Drum by Cleveland composer Eric Gould. Performing with the Cleveland Chamber Symphony and jazz ensemble with African percussion, the piece will showcase Glover in spirited tap solos that reflect the history of dance rhythms from Africa to the Americas. Also featured is “The Starz and Stripes 4ever for Now”, patterned by Glover after John Coltrane’s “My Favorite Things.”
